Comment: The logic of tax revenue can be counterintuitive. To many progressives, it makes sense to tax the rich more: they make more money, so they can pay more. But that only works to a degree, because when the tax rate is too high, rich people simply find a way of avoiding taxes, by moving their money somewhere with a lower tax rate or off shore. Lowering tax rates actually provides an incentive to stay local and pay taxes. That's how Russia started getting tax revenue again after the disastrous '90s, for instance: a simple flat tax rate. After just one year, tax revenue increased 26%.
